We provide experimental evidence for a transition from a random-matrix
ensemble with broken time-reversal symmetry to an ensemble with parti
ally broken spin-rotation symmetry. The transition from a Gaussian uni
tary ensemble to the ensemble in which the Zeeman degeneracy of electr
ons is lifted is accompanied by a factor of 2 change in 1/f noise fluc
tuations measured in a mesoscopic Li wire at low temperature. The magn
etic-field scale characterizing the Zeeman crossover is determined by
k(B)T, rather than by the Thouless energy.
